What are the tax responsibilities for nonprofit organizations in Ecuador?
Nonprofit organizations in Ecuador may be exempt from certain taxes, but still have specific tax responsibilities. This includes the submission of annual returns, proper documentation of activities and transparency in the management of funds. The tax benefits for these organizations are tied to their social mission, and compliance with regulations is crucial to maintain their favorable tax status.
What is the deadline to retain labor records in Paraguay?
Labor records in Paraguay must generally be retained for at least 5 years, according to labor regulations, to allow auditing and oversight by competent authorities.
Can judicial records be used in divorce or child custody cases in Panama?
In divorce or child custody cases in Panama, judicial records may be used as part of the evaluation of the suitability of the parents or guardians. This background may be relevant to determine the safety and well-being of the minors involved.
What is the process to request a declaration of interdiction for a person with a disability in Ecuador?
The process to request the declaration of interdiction of a person with a disability in Ecuador involves filing a complaint before a judge for children and adolescents. Evidence must be provided to demonstrate the person's inability to exercise their rights themselves and the need to appoint a conservator to protect their interests.
